Meetup: A modular approach before micro-services

Real architecture tips and use cases experience, was the theme of the two talks at the last PHP meetup organized by Sebastian Feldmann at CHECK24.

My photos from the event

In the first session, we followed Sebastian’s journey and lessons learned while moving applications from monolith, to distributed monolith, to modular monolith, and eventually to microservices, if that last step is really necessary.

It was a very well-delivered talk with plenty of relatable examples that many of us have faced in our own projects. A really great experience speaking about "The Holy Grail of Software Architecture".

The second talk: Democratic Architecture, was presented by Stefan Priebsch, who shared insights on how responsibilities and competencies can be distributed within an architecture, whether modular or distributed, and how respecting these boundaries helps define the scope of each component, module, or app as a whole.
